Carta

Pros

  • Comprehensive Equity Management: Carta offers a complete suite of tools for managing all aspects of equity, from cap tables to liquidity events.
  • Automation & Efficiency: Automates many manual equity-related tasks, saving time and reducing errors.
  • Compliance Focus: Helps companies stay compliant with complex equity regulations, such as 409A and ASC 820.

Cons

  • Potential Complexity: The platform's extensive features can be overwhelming for smaller companies with simpler equity structures.
  • Cost: Can be expensive for early-stage startups with limited budgets.
FundCount

Pros

  • Comprehensive portfolio and partnership accounting capabilities
  • Automated workflows and direct data feeds improve efficiency
  • Flexible reporting and analytical insights
  • Multicurrency support for international investments

Cons

  • Potential complexity for smaller firms with simpler investment needs
  • Implementation may require significant setup and training
